Although I fully disagree w/sending a dog from home-to-home to spend time with different owners, I feel what they are doing is commendable as they use rescued and/or rehomed dogs. From their website, it sounds as though all their dogs come through from rescue orgs or from people who can no longer care for their canine companion. This is much better than what my original thoughts were, which I thought they were using either puppmills or backyard breeders.

I kind of feel for the dogs b/c they live with one "primary" owner with their other Flexpets pals, then bounce between home to home "visiting" with "members". If people want to spend "some" time with a dog, but cannot afford (time and/or money wise) to have a dog fulltime, why don't they just volunteer at a local shelter or something?

Another good thing about this site, is that these dogs are often adopted out. The "member" becomes attached and wants to keep the dog full time, in which case they adopt their new friend. This is great.

Maybe this website is a way to get people to interact with the dogs in hopes they will get attached and end up adopting them...

It just seems to me that it would be stressful on these lil canines...

I think it's a bit weird but apparently they do this in Japan, too. Apartments are small and people work a lot of hours so they don't feel like they should own a dog so you can rent dogs in four hour increments. I'm not sure about them being rescued (but if the pet industry is like Korea at all I'm going to say they aren't).
